Pizza Pirate has saved me and my husband many times over the last few years with hot, fresh pasta, kid-friendly options, and so many delicious garlic twists. Sometimes it was when we couldn’t find the energy to cook at home so did a quick call in and pick up, and sometimes it’s because we had a craving to eat out, and each time, we’ve had a great experience and meal! When it was time to help plan my daughter’s end of year school party, pizza was an easy choice for feeding 100 first graders! I contacted Pat at Pizza Pirate a couple weeks before the last day of school to see if Pizza Pirate could accommodate a big order, have them ready before they officially opened, and make sure pizzas were double-cut to limit precious wasted pizza. Not only did Pat respond to each and every email with lightning speed time to accommodate us, he generously gave us the pizzas half off to help maximize our budget for the party and kids. Pizza Pirate is the only place in town my kids love and we’ll be making sure we support them all summer long. After the party, my daughter thanked me for coordinating and exclaimed, I ate four pieces, which is a BIG win for my usually picky eater. Thanks to Pat and the Pizza Pirate team for helping us close the school year right!

Slow place. Would of expected more out of the raviolis and bread twists with soda we got for around $30. Food is not too bad. Clean place though. Could be better. By the ways what up with this all genders bathroom sign and the third person?

For $35 I expected some kind of greens on a plate not a small soup bowl. The ravioli looks empty inside. The silverware is limp plastic. It took about 45 minutes to get an order of just two items. Aaarg matey, it's all theme but no dream.

Love the pizza but seriously a surcharge for using a card to pay? This is how you tell customes you can charge them whatever and too bad if you don't like it. Surcharge was only 1.81 but I did buy 60 bucks worth of food. Napoli pizza is closer so I think that is where we need to go from now on and the food is just as good if not better. Sorry pirate but this was not cool and I have been buying from there since the 80s

Hit or miss. Love how fresh the topping are. The Crust is hit or miss sometimes great sometimes doughy. Salad are a skip now that the salad bar is gone.

I've always enjoyed the food at Pizza Pirate and they have a fair selection of beer. On weekends and often in the summer, it gets busy and very loud with all the kids who love going there for the games and freedom to run around. It's an institution in Benicia. Their salad bar is gone because of Covid, but their pizza is still great.
